I have a Dell D600 running Gutsy, upgraded from Feisty.  
xorg version is currently 1:7.2-5ubuntu13.
xserver-xorg-video-ati version is currently 1:6.7.196-1ubuntu2.
My xorg.conf contains
...
Section "Monitor"
        Identifier      "Generic Monitor"
        Option          "DPMS"
        DisplaySize     285 215
EndSection
...

/var/logs/Xorg.0.log contains
...
(II) RADEON(0): Output LVDS using initial mode 1400x1050
after xf86InitialConfiguration
(**) RADEON(0): Display dimensions: (285, 215) mm
(**) RADEON(0): DPI set to (124, 141)
...
Note that the Y component of DPI is calculated incorrectly!

xdpyinfo says
...
  dimensions:    1400x1050 pixels (370x277 millimeters)
  resolution:    96x96 dots per inch
...
So the specified dimensions, and the calculated DPI values, are not taking 
effect.
